Output 56a3561424c4220f1a75d99c1989da2155c35bb7ab8d69c0fec22aaa17675f22:24

value
312548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24197d9c4fc4500032a8e6c9394f6d8e2879529f OP_EQUAL
address
34ytna98TkUb3XD2wSJQPK9QuUJRVkQYbE
transaction
56a3561424c4220f1a75d99c1989da2155c35bb7ab8d69c0fec22aaa17675f22
spent
true